With the continuous development of world economy, and the increasing use of energy, the utilization of energy is put forward the higher requirements. Boiler is an important thermal power equipment, so the quality control of the boiler system directly affects their operational efficiency. And if the efficiency of boiler is lower, it will cause energy wasted and environmental pollutded.In order to save energy and improve the boilers’ utilization, form of resource allocation mode combining, seeking a kind of efficient coal combustion technology is becoming an urgent demand for the industrialized world.This paper studies the circulating fluidized bed boiler (Circulating Fluidized Bed Boiler). The CFB has many advantages, such as low pollution, fuel wide adaptability, high load regulation, excellent performance. So electric power industry is applied more widely in our country at present. However, the boiler combustion control system is a multi-variable, nonlinear, time-varying, big lag of complex control object, so its work principle is relatively complex. Also because the unit is running rarely, less operational experience and inadequate design resources, conventional automatic control methods cannot achieve the desired control effect. And there are many problems when using computers to establish a mathematical model of a circulating fluidized bed boiler,and simulate it. So an urgent requirement and strong demand is needed for a smart way to achieve intelligent control of the circulating fluidized bed boiler.The purpose of this paper is analyzing the scene of accident working conditions. And the paper combines with the structure of 330MW circulating fluidized bed boiler and combustion characteristics, and focuses on the combustion control system of circulating fluidized bed boiler. Furthermore, because of the coal on-line correction into the combustion control which the paper has introduced, combustion control logic has been more perfected, the rate of AGC response also has been improved effectively. In summary the contents of this paper has certain application and popularization value for the China’s power industry.
